Abigail Cessna relocated from New York to Washington, DC when she decided to focus her practice on complex antitrust work. She shares the importance of finding what you love – and having the courage to go for it.

Antitrust combines much of what interests me about law. This area of law presents the opportunity to immerse myself in a client’s business and advocate for its interests. The practice has a strong regulatory component, so there is much substantive knowledge to learn. The many recent developments in antitrust afford me the chance to work on cutting-edge issues. Of particular interest to me is the intersection between antitrust and technology.
